Recycling
Recycling is arguably the most recognizable initiative of America's environmental programs because it's something everyone can do-at home, work, and school, as well as at stores and parks. By removing recyclable materials from the waste stream, we conserve natural resources, reduce energy use, and decrease emissions of greenhouse gases and air and water pollutants. Individuals can do their part by participating in the many Federal, State, and local recycling programs available.
